-mandate-isnt-over/ Connecticut House, Senate Republicans Say Fight
Against EV Mandate Isn’t Over

“Democrats will renew their push after
Election Day to ban gas-powered vehicles and they’ll use this ‘roadmap’
as a selling point to justify their decision with a skeptical public,
claiming they’ve researched and addressed with everyone’s concerns. The
reality, though, is that this council created by this bill is a public
relations tool designed to shoehorn our state into the California’s
radical emissions standards. It isn’t a catalyst to develop solutions
to citizens’ common sense concerns about cost, charging infrastructure
and freedom of choice," said House Republican Leader Vincent Candelora
and Senate Republican Leader Stephen Harding.
